Transaction 5593f18d8764d9bfd17a3c547dac62a098882efeb0df661c5faa07e9b617b6ee

1 Input
2 Outputs
  • 5593f18d8764d9bfd17a3c547dac62a098882efeb0df661c5faa07e9b617b6ee:0
  • value  2863069
    address  32pbWdhtwg8uo8hKaAKyW9mhWN1e8dug1R
  • 5593f18d8764d9bfd17a3c547dac62a098882efeb0df661c5faa07e9b617b6ee:1
  • value  10450546
    address  3HvhNWNLFhfizCXvkbkq35RVK9FzzwvgkG